The Jeep Cherokee XJ, produced from 1984 to 2001, is a compact sport utility vehicle (SUV) that earned a legendary reputation for its ruggedness, off-road capability, and affordability. The 1997 model year, specifically, stands out for its updated styling, refined interior, and improved performance. Introduced in 1997, the Cherokee XJ received a significant facelift, featuring a new grille, headlights, and bumpers. This update gave the Cherokee a more modern and aerodynamic appearance, while retaining its iconic boxy shape. Inside, the 1997 XJ received upgrades like a redesigned dashboard, revised upholstery options, and optional features like a CD player and a power sunroof. These improvements aimed to enhance comfort and convenience for both driver and passengers. Under the hood, the 1997 Cherokee XJ continued to offer a range of robust powertrains. The base engine was a 4.0-liter inline-six, known for its reliability and smooth power delivery. Optionally, a 2.5-liter four-cylinder engine was available, offering better fuel economy. The Cherokee XJ's reputation as a capable off-roader was solidified by its sturdy build, high ground clearance, and advanced four-wheel-drive system. A variety of suspension packages were available, including the "Renegade" and "Country" trims, which offered different levels of capability for tackling various terrains. The 1997 Jeep Cherokee XJ remained a popular choice for drivers seeking a blend of practicality, off-road prowess, and an iconic American design. Its enduring appeal is evident in its continued popularity among enthusiasts and collectors today.
